KUALA LUMPUR — Attorney General (AG) Tommy Thomas cancelled a scheduled press conference on Datuk Seri Najib Razak’s trial after the latter’s supporters became aggressive in the vicinity.
The group began berating Thomas as he approached the lobby of the Kuala Lumpur Courts Complex where the press conference had been arranged, denouncing him for conducting the court proceedings in English earlier.
Guna Bahasa Malaysia! (Use Bahasa Malaysia!)” the cries came at first, before rising to a crescendo of shouts.
Thomas earlier sought the court’s permission to proceed with the former PM’s prosecution in English.
The crowd mocked him repeatedly, with some questioning his citizenship for not being fluent in BM.
Thomas stood and smiled as he waited for the crowd to settle down, but walked away when it became apparent that they were becoming increasingly agitated.
Actress Ellie Suriaty Omar, believed to be the instigator of the chants, then had her MyKad taken by police personnel who were attempting to calm the group.
Thomas called later for another press conference, this time on an upper floor free of the former PM’s supporters.
The crowd moved outside the lobby when police escorted some of the more hostile protesters outside, where the shouting and jostling continued. – MALAY MAIL

ATTORNEY-GENERAL Tommy Thomas will oppose an interim gag order by the court in his prosecution against former prime minister Najib Razak.
He said the gag order, requested by Najib’s lead counsel, Muhammad Shafee Abdullah, is unnecessary.
“A gag order was not something we asked for. We object to that.
“How wide is the scope of the gag order? We were taken by surprise,” said Thomas, who is leading the prosecution, during a press conference after the court proceedings today.
Shafee argued that the gag order is crucial to prevent statements that could affect his client’s case from being published.
He cited alleged incidents where his client had been subjected to a “trial by media”, even before today’s court appearance.
Judge Sofian Abd Razak permitted the interim gag order on the media, which prevents the publication of statements or materials on the merits of Najib’s case.
He said Shafee needs to apply to make the gag order permanent, and the interim order is valid for only 14 days.
Thomas said he will wait and see what the gag order entails before applying to strike it out.
Earlier in court, he said he will oppose the gag order as it curbs freedom of speech, which is important when it comes to high-profile cases such as Najib’s.
“We will object strenuously. The rest of the world is talking about it. The rest of the world will be commenting on the case, and Malaysians would be keeping quiet.
“They need to make a formal application. We will vigorously oppose.”  – THE MALAYSIAN INSIGHT
